Многие владельцы ноутбуков сталкиваются с ситуацией, когда современные игры или тяжелые графические программы выдают ошибку нехватки видеопамяти. Часто это происходит с устройствами, имеющими интегрированную графику, которая использует часть общей оперативной памяти компьютера. Желание ускорить работу системы и запустить требовательные приложения заставляет пользователей искать способы искусственного увеличения объема VRAM.
Следует сразу прояснить важный технический нюанс: физически увеличить объем памяти на чипе Intel UHD Graphics или AMD Radeon Vega невозможно. Эти компоненты не имеют собственных микросхем памяти, а заимствуют ресурсы у системной RAM. Однако, программно можно изменить лимит выделения памяти, что часто помогает в запуске игр и улучшении производительности интерфейса.
В этой статье мы разберем все доступные методы конфигурации, начиная от настройки BIOS и заканчивая оптимизацией параметров Windows. Вы узнаете, какие параметры действительно влияют на производительность, а какие являются лишь маркетинговой уловкой.
Понимание архитектуры интегрированной графики
Чтобы эффективно управлять настройками, необходимо понимать принцип работы динамического выделения памяти. В отличие от дискретных видеокарт, которые имеют фиксированный объем собственной памяти (4 ГБ, 8 ГБ и т.д.), встроенные решения не обладают постоянным хранилищем для текстур и кадрового буфера.
Система автоматически выделяет под графику необходимый объем из оперативной памяти (RAM) в зависимости от текущей нагрузки. Если вы запускаете легкий браузер, выделено может быть 128 МБ, а при открытии игры этот объем может вырасти до 512 МБ или 1 ГБ автоматически. Проблема возникает, когда игра требует конкретного значения в свойствах, которое превышает стандартный порог, установленный производителем.
Критически важно понимать: выделение памяти в BIOS не создает новую физическую память, а лишь меняет лимит, который система может резервировать для видеоадаптера. Это означает, что ваши программы будут работать быстрее, но общий объем доступной памяти для операционной системы уменьшится на соответствующую величину.
⚠️ Внимание: Изменение настроек в BIOS может привести к нестабильной работе системы, если выделите слишком большой объем памяти. Убедитесь, что у вас установлено минимум 16 ГБ ОЗУ, прежде чем выделять под графику более 2 ГБ.
Настройка выделения памяти через BIOS/UEFI
Самый надежный способ увеличить доступный объем VRAM — это вход в конфигурацию системной платы. Этот метод работает на большинстве ноутбуков с процессорами Intel и AMD, хотя названия меню могут отличаться в зависимости от производителя (ASUS, Lenovo, HP, Dell).
Для начала необходимо перезагрузить устройство и во время загрузки нажать специальную клавишу, обычно это F2, Del или F10. В открывшемся интерфейсе UEFI нужно искать разделы с названиями Advanced, Chipset или Graphics Configuration. В некоторых современных ноутбуках этот параметр может быть скрыт в разделе System Configuration.
Найдите параметр Dedicated Video Memory, Share Memory или UMA Frame Buffer Size. Внутри этого пункта часто доступен выбор фиксированных значений: 32M, 64M, 128M, 256M, 512M, 1G или 2G. Установите максимальное доступное значение и сохраните изменения, нажав F10.
☑️ Подготовка к настройке BIOS
Если вы не можете найти нужный параметр, это может означать, что производитель заблокировал эту возможность или использует автоматическое управление без ручного вмешательства. В таких случаях стоит проверить наличие обновлений прошивки BIOS на официальном сайте производителя.
⚠️ Внимание: Если в меню BIOS отсутствует пункт настройки видеопамяти, не пытайтесь искать сторонние модифицированные версии микрокода, так как это может привести к полной неработоспособности ноутбука (кирпичеванию).
Почему некоторые ноутбуки не позволяют менять настройки?|Производители часто ограничивают доступ к этим настройкам, чтобы избежать конфликтов с операционной системой или некорректной работы в режиме энергосбережения, когда слишком много памяти резервируется впустую.-->
Редактирование реестра Windows для обхода ограничений
Если BIOS не дает нужных результатов, можно попытаться обмануть игру, заставив ее «думать», что у видеокарты больше памяти. Это делается через системный реестр. Данный метод не увеличивает реальную производительность, но позволяет запустить игры, которые блокируются из-за проверки объема VRAM.
Откройте редактор реестра, нажав комбинацию Win + R и введя команду regedit. Перейдите по пути HKEY_LOCAL_MACHINE\Software\Intel\GMM. Если раздела GMM не существует, создайте его, кликнув правой кнопкой мыши на папке Intel и выбрав Создать → Раздел.
Внутри создайте параметр DWORD (32 бита) с именем DedicatedSegmentSize. В настройках значения укажите количество памяти в мегабайтах. Например, чтобы установить 512 МБ, введите число 512 в десятичной системе счисления. Перезагрузите компьютер для применения изменений.
reg add "HKLM\Software\Intel\GMM" /v DedicatedSegmentSize /t REG_DWORD /d 512 /f
После перезагрузки зайдите в свойства дисплея и проверьте статус видеокарты. В некоторых случаях система может показать увеличенный объем, но это будет лишь отражение записи в реестре, а не реального физического изменения.
Win + R и введя команду regedit. Перейдите по пути HKEY_LOCAL_MACHINE\Software\Intel\GMM. Если раздела GMM не существует, создайте его, кликнув правой кнопкой мыши на папке Intel и выбрав Создать → Раздел.DedicatedSegmentSize. В настройках значения укажите количество памяти в мегабайтах. Например, чтобы установить 512 МБ, введите число 512 в десятичной системе счисления. Перезагрузите компьютер для применения изменений.reg add "HKLM\Software\Intel\GMM" /v DedicatedSegmentSize /t REG_DWORD /d 512 /f